         As we prepare for Championships, remember to focus on the things you can control. 

         Get plenty of sleep each night so your body has time to recover. Stay hydrated by drinking plenty of water throughout the week. Fuel your body with nutritious foods and avoid excess candy, soda, and sugary snacks that can affect your energy. Take time to visualize your races. See yourself executing great starts, powerful underwater dolphin kicks, efficient turns, and strong finishes. Arrive prepared with extra towels, healthy snacks, water, sunscreen, and, most importantly, a positive attitude.

         Remember, swimming is as much a mental sport as it is a physical one. Believe in yourself. Trust your training. Stay focused on your goals, and have confidence in the work you’ve put in all season. When you step behind the blocks, know that you are ready.
